Q: Once my screen saver is installed, how do I find it?
A: In Windows 3.1: Go to your "Main" group and double click on "Control Panel". Then double click on "Desktop". The screen saver section is the third box down. In Windows 95 or NT: Click on Start, then choose settings, then control panel. Double click on "Display" and select the "Screen Saver" tab.
Q: How do I uninstall screen savers?
A: Most screen saver files get installed into the "Windows" directory. Try looking for files with a .scr extension (example: fred.scr) in the windows directory, and you can just delete the particular one you want to remove.
